Abstract

Information regarding an apparatus state of a substrate processing apparatus is collected, and whether an operation with respect to a portion in the apparatus is possible is determined based on the state information. When it is dangerous to perform an operation with respect to the portion, it is determined that the portion cannot be operated. A display unit of smart glasses performs coloring display based on the determination result with respect to a portion (visually recognizable portion) that can be seen by the operator among the determined portions. On the other hand, coloring display is not performed with respect to the portion that cannot be seen by the operator. The operator can easily and clearly recognize whether the portion to be worked can be operated regardless of the situation of the portion that cannot be seen.

TECHNICAL FIELD The present invention relates to a work assistance method and a work assistance system used when predetermined work such as maintenance work is performed on industrial equipment such as a substrate processing apparatus that performs predetermined processing on a substrate. Substrates to be processed by the substrate processing apparatus include, for example, a semiconductor substrate, a substrate for a liquid crystal display apparatus, a substrate for a flat panel display (FPD), a substrate for an optical disk, a substrate for a magnetic disk, or a substrate for a solar cell. BACKGROUND ART Conventionally, in a semiconductor device manufacturing process, a substrate processing apparatus that performs various types of processing on a substrate such as a semiconductor substrate is used. As the substrate processing apparatus, for example, a substrate cleaning apparatus, a heat treatment apparatus, an inspection apparatus, and the like are used. Typically, a large number of substrate processing apparatuses are disposed orderly in a wide clean room in many cases. Maintenance is performed on these substrate processing apparatuses at an appropriate timing. Patent Document 1 describes that a large number of substrate processing apparatuses are arranged at a relatively high density in a clean room and maintenance of the substrate processing apparatuses is performed. PRIOR ART DOCUMENT PATENT DOCUMENT Patent Document 1: Japanese Patent Application Laid-Open No. 2020-4866 SUMMARY PROBLEM TO BE SOLVED BY THE INVENTION When maintenance of the substrate processing apparatus is performed, an operator may open a cover of a chamber or perform construction on a pipe. However, the inside of the chamber may be in a dangerous state. For example, when the inside of the chamber is purged with nitrogen gas, the inside of the chamber is in a dangerous state in which oxygen is hardly present. In addition, immediately after a chemical liquid such as hydrofluoric acid is used, there is a possibility that the chamber is filled with vapor of the chemical liquid, or droplets of the chemical liquid are attached. Further, the residual pressure in the pipe routed to the chamber may be high. When the inside of the chamber is in a dangerous state as described above, the operator opening the cover may lead to an accident. Thus, when the inside of the chamber is in a dangerous state, the cover should not be opened. However, the dangerous state as described above is not visible to human eyes, and it is difficult for the operator to determine whether to open the cover. The present invention has been made in view of the above-described problem, and an object of the present invention is to provide a work assistance method and a work assistance system that allow an operator to easily recognize whether a portion to be worked can be operated.
